HTML5开发全解析:从缓存到混合应用与新特性探索
1. 开启HTML5之旅
在Symbian或Maemo设备上启动fancybrowser,访问存放“Hello World”内容的网站,可能需输入类似 http://mysite.com/hworld.html 的地址。触摸“Hello World”文本,检查是否按预期旋转,若成功旋转,说明一切正常,可继续后续开发。
2. 使用HTML5应用缓存
传统网络托管的Web应用存在问题,即必须联网才能访问。对于桌面电脑,可靠网络连接下这不是问题,但对于移动设备,网络连接常不稳定,如驾车过隧道或超出覆盖区时可能长时间无网络。HTML5的应用缓存功能可解决此问题,使Web应用在离线时也能使用。
缓存通常作为HTTP缓存实现,而HTML5应用缓存是新机制,开发者可通过清单文件(manifest)明确管理应用的缓存行为。例如,hworld应用使用 hworld.html 、 hworld.css 和 hworld.js 三个文件, hworld.html 的头部元素可能如下:
<head>
<title>Hello World</title>
<script src="hworld.js"></script>
<link rel="stylesheet" href="hworld.css">
</head
超级会员免费看
订阅专栏 解锁全文

被折叠的 条评论
为什么被折叠?



